@file:Suppress("unused")

package com.github.penemue.keap

import org.openjdk.jmh.annotations.*
import org.openjdk.jmh.infra.Blackhole
import java.util.*
import java.util.concurrent.TimeUnit

open class KeapQueueOrderedBenchmark : OrderedBenchmarkBase() {

    override fun createQueue(): Queue<String> {
        return PriorityQueue()
    }
}

open class JavaQueueOrderedBenchmark : OrderedBenchmarkBase() {

    override fun createQueue(): Queue<String> {
        return java.util.PriorityQueue()
    }
}

@State(Scope.Thread)
@OutputTimeUnit(TimeUnit.MICROSECONDS)
abstract class OrderedBenchmarkBase {

    private companion object {
        private const val PRIORITY_QUEUE_SIZE = 10000
    }

    private var queue: Queue<String>? = null
    private var increasingCounter = 1000000000000000000L
    private var increasingElement = ""
    private var decreasingCounter = 1000000000000000000L
    private var decreasingElement = ""

    @Setup
    fun setupBenchmark() {
        queue = createQueue()
    }

    @Setup(Level.Invocation)
    fun setupInvocation() {
        while (queue!!.size > PRIORITY_QUEUE_SIZE) {
            queue!!.poll()
        }
        increasingElement = "0000000000${++increasingCounter}"
        decreasingElement = "0000000000${--decreasingCounter}"
    }

    @Benchmark
    @Warmup(iterations = 5, time = 1)
    @Measurement(iterations = 5, time = 1)
    @Fork(4)
    fun offerIncreasing(bh: Blackhole) {
        bh.consume(queue!!.offer(increasingElement))
    }

    @Benchmark
    @Warmup(iterations = 5, time = 1)
    @Measurement(iterations = 5, time = 1)
    @Fork(4)
    fun offerDecreasing(bh: Blackhole) {
        bh.consume(queue!!.offer(decreasingElement))
    }

    abstract fun createQueue(): Queue<String>
}
